LUXULLIANITE

One of Britain’s rarest and most attractive rocks

280 million years old


Luxulyan, near St. Austell, Cornwall
 

Luxullianite is only found in one place in the world: the village of Luxulyan in Cornwall, after which the rock has been named. It is a very distinctive and handsome rock with a brilliant name.

Luxullianite is actually a variety of granite, with pink orthoclase feldspar crystals intermingled with black tourmaline and white quartz. 
 
The Duke of Wellington’s sarcophagus in St. Paul’s Cathedral in London is made of luxullianite.
